| CPU | Rockchip RK3576, Octa-core, 2.2 GHz |
| DDR | Standard 4G (8G/16G Optional) LP DDR4 |
| EMMC | Standard 32G (64G / 128G / 256G Optional) |
| Operating System | Android 14.0 (kernel is Linux 5.10) |
| Network Support | Support 4G, Connect To PCI-E Interface 4G Module |
| Serial Port | 7 total: 6 TTL Serial Ports (optional 4 RS232 and 2 RS485), 1 Debug |
| USB Interface | 7 total: 1 USB3.0 OTG, 1 USB3.0 HOST, 5 USB 2.0 HOST |
| RTC Real Time Clock | The battery supports time memory for 3 years and supports timed power on and off |
| System Upgrade | Support USB Cable / U Disk / Network Upgrade |
